Q: Is 12,380,320 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 12,380,320 is a composite number.

Why is 12,380,320 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 12,380,320 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 8 10 16 20 32 40 80 160 77,377 154,754 309,508 386,885 619,016 773,770 1,238,032 1,547,540 2,476,064 3,095,080 6,190,160 and 12,380,320, with no remainder.

Since 12,380,320 cannot be divided by just 1 and 12,380,320, it is a composite number.
